是的,有一个脚本可以检查列表中的链接并确定它们是否正常工作。这个脚本可以通过发送HTTP请求来检查链接的状态码,从而确定链接是否可用。以下是一个示例脚本:
import requests
def check_links(links):
for link in links:
try:
response = requests.head(link)
if response.status_code == 200:
print(f"{link} is working fine.")
else:
print(f"{link} is not working. Status code: {response.status_code}")
except requests.exceptions.RequestException as e:
print(f"{link} is not working. Error: {e}")
# 要检查的链接列表
links = [
"https://www.example.com",
"https://www.google.com",
"https://www.invalidlink.com"
]
check_links(links)
这个脚本使用了Python的requests库来发送HTTP请求。它遍历给定的链接列表,对每个链接发送HEAD请求,并检查返回的状态码。如果状态码为200,则表示链接正常工作;否则,表示链接不可用。
对于这个脚本,你可以使用腾讯云的云服务器(CVM)来运行。腾讯云的CVM提供了稳定可靠的计算资源,适合运行各种应用程序和脚本。你可以通过以下链接了解更多关于腾讯云云服务器的信息:腾讯云云服务器产品介绍
请注意,以上答案仅供参考,实际情况可能因环境和需求而异。
领取专属 10元无门槛券
手把手带您无忧上云